Dealmonger: Phil Wood Hand Cleaner $7

AirBomb is selling a 16oz. tub of Phil Wood Hand Cleaner for $6.80. A friend who’s a professional bike mechanic sent me a tub of it recently, claiming it was the best hand cleaner he’d used. After several weeks I have to agree — it’s mild, relatively unscented, yet cleans grease and dirt as completely as any hand cleaner I’ve used before.

Mr. Miz,
Phil wood makes wonderful bicycle hubs, bottom brackets and other odds and ends in the USA. Exquisite quality. Google Phil Wood and check it out
And some of the best bearing grease on the planet. Totally one of the mainstays of snobby bike maintenance.
